What is Adult ADHD?
ADHD in adults presents distinctively compared to children. While manifesting behaviors such as trouble sustaining attention, off-task habits, and impulsive decision-making, adult ADHD may likewise manifest in relationship issues, career challenges, and psychological dysregulation.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), roughly 4.4% of adults in the U.S. are identified with ADHD.

1. Initial Consultation
This is an informal meeting where the customer discusses their issues. The clinician will gather an in-depth history, including:
Medical historyFamily history of ADHD or related conditionsAcademic, occupational, and social history2. Diagnostic Interviews
Structured interviews, such as the Diagnostic Interview for ADHD in Adults (DIVA), are conducted. These last around 60 to 90 minutes. The clinician will ask specific questions connected to the criteria set by the DSM-5.
3. Self-Report Questionnaires
Clients often complete standardized self-assessment tools, such as:
QuestionnaireFunctionAdult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S)To identify ADHD-related symptomsBarratt Impulsiveness Scale (BIS)To assess impulsivity and attention4. Review of External Reports
The clinician might request reports from previous education, work assessments, or interviews with member of the family to collect an extensive image of the individual's behavior over time.
5. Feedback Session
After the evaluation, a follow-up session is set up to go over the findings, supply a medical diagnosis if applicable, and suggest treatment.
